const (
	// OvnNodeL3GatewayConfig is the constant string representing the l3 gateway annotation key
	OvnNodeL3GatewayConfig = "k8s.ovn.org/l3-gateway-config"

	// OvnNodeGatewayMtuSupport determines if option:gateway_mtu shall be set for GR router ports.
	OvnNodeGatewayMtuSupport = "k8s.ovn.org/gateway-mtu-support"

	// OvnNodeManagementPort is the constant string representing the annotation key
	OvnNodeManagementPort = "k8s.ovn.org/node-mgmt-port"

	// OvnNodeManagementPortMacAddress is the constant string representing the annotation key
	OvnNodeManagementPortMacAddress = "k8s.ovn.org/node-mgmt-port-mac-address"

	// OvnNodeChassisID is the systemID of the node needed for creating L3 gateway
	OvnNodeChassisID = "k8s.ovn.org/node-chassis-id"

	// OvnNodeIfAddr is the CIDR form representation of primary network interface's attached IP address (i.e: 192.168.126.31/24 or 0:0:0:0:0:feff:c0a8:8e0c/64)
	OvnNodeIfAddr = "k8s.ovn.org/node-primary-ifaddr"

	// OVNNodeHostCIDRs is used to track the different host IP addresses and subnet masks on the node
	OVNNodeHostCIDRs = "k8s.ovn.org/host-cidrs"

	// OVNNodeSecondaryHostEgressIPs contains EgressIP addresses that aren't managed by OVN. The EIP addresses are assigned to
	// standard linux interfaces and not interfaces of type OVS.
	OVNNodeSecondaryHostEgressIPs = "k8s.ovn.org/secondary-host-egress-ips"

	// OvnNodeZoneName is the zone to which the node belongs to. It is set by ovnkube-node.
	// ovnkube-node gets the node's zone from the OVN Southbound database.
	OvnNodeZoneName = "k8s.ovn.org/zone-name"

	/** HACK BEGIN **/
	// TODO(tssurya): Remove this annotation a few months from now (when one or two release jump
	// upgrades are done). This has been added only to minimize disruption for upgrades when
	// moving to interconnect=true.
	// We want the legacy ovnkube-master to wait for remote ovnkube-node to
	// signal it using "k8s.ovn.org/remote-zone-migrated" annotation before
	// considering a node as remote when we upgrade from "global" (1 zone IC)
	// zone to multi-zone. This is so that network disruption for the existing workloads
	// is negligible and until the point where ovnkube-node flips the switch to connect
	// to the new SBDB, it would continue talking to the legacy RAFT ovnkube-sbdb to ensure
	// OVN/OVS flows are intact.
	// OvnNodeMigratedZoneName is the zone to which the node belongs to. It is set by ovnkube-node.
	// ovnkube-node gets the node's zone from the OVN Southbound database.
	OvnNodeMigratedZoneName = "k8s.ovn.org/remote-zone-migrated"

	// InvalidNodeID indicates an invalid node id
	InvalidNodeID = -1

	// invalidNetworkID signifies its an invalid network id
	InvalidNetworkID = -1
)

type PodAnnotation

type PodAnnotation struct {
	// IPs are the pod's assigned IP addresses/prefixes
	IPs []*net.IPNet
	// MAC is the pod's assigned MAC address
	MAC net.HardwareAddr
	// Gateways are the pod's gateway IP addresses; note that there may be
	// fewer Gateways than IPs.
	Gateways []net.IP
	// Routes are additional routes to add to the pod's network namespace
	Routes []PodRoute

	// TunnelID assigned to each pod for layer2 secondary networks
	TunnelID int
}

PodAnnotation describes the assigned network details for a single pod network. (The actual annotation may include the equivalent of multiple PodAnnotations.)

func UnmarshalPodAnnotation

func UnmarshalPodAnnotation(annotations map[string]string, nadName string) (*PodAnnotation, error)

UnmarshalPodAnnotation returns the Pod's network info of the given network from pod.Annotations

type PodRoute

type PodRoute struct {
	// Dest is the route destination
	Dest *net.IPNet
	// NextHop is the IP address of the next hop for traffic destined for Dest
	NextHop net.IP
}

PodRoute describes any routes to be added to the pod's network namespace
